Dockerfile 362 B

12345678910
  1. FROM frolvlad/alpine-java
  2. VOLUME /app
  3. WORKDIR /app
  4. ADD target/*.jar app.jar
  5. RUN apk add tzdata && cp /usr/share/zoneinfo/Asia/Shanghai /etc/localtime && echo "Asia/Shanghai" > /etc/timezone && apk del tzdata
  6. ENTRYPOINT ["sh", "-c", "java -Dserver.port=8080 -Duser.timezone=GMT+8 -Dspring.profiles.active=cloud ${JAVA_OPTS} -jar app.jar ${0} ${@}"]
  7. EXPOSE 8080